Job Number AP00025P Position Title Student Success Coach II - District Pool Position Type Non Academic/Non Classified Percentage Employee Number of Months Assignment 12 Starting Date As soon as possible Current Work Schedule Days and hours of employment varies Monday through Friday 8:00 AM – 7:00 PM, including some weekends and evenings. Salary Range Salary $19.00 per hour (up to 19 hours per week) Shift Differential FLSA Non-Exempt Location Main Campus Department Student Services Open Date 10/15/2020 Closing Date Open Until Filled No About Rio Hondo College About Río Hondo College Río Hondo College welcomes and embraces all students in their educational and career pathways. As a Hispanic-Serving Institution (HSI), our College has a student population of 22,000, of which 18,000 are Latinx students. We were the first college in Los Angeles County to provide two years of free tuition to first-time, full-time college students through our Río Promise program. We are proud to acknowledge that many of our students have transferred to high ranked institutions such as Harvard, Stanford, USC and UCLA, UC Berkeley, UC Irvine, Cal State LA, Cal State Long Beach, and Whittier College to name a few. Strengths Our caring and dedicated student-centered staff, faculty, and administrators are devoted to the advancement of educational justice, equity, and opportunity for all our students. Our College’s 900 employees, with close to 600 faculty, hold themselves accountable for the academic success of disproportionately impacted student populations. Our entire staff, with unwavering team collaboration, work hard to ensure our students reach their full potential by eliminating gaps in academic outcomes that traditionally hinder students of color. Río Hondo College is committed to the recruitment of qualified and diverse employees who are dedicated to our students’ success.
